Internet tricked by fake Star Ocean Multiple Platform Information

The source of the score appears to be an individual who wished to fool users on the popular NeoGAF forums by making up a load of review scores and news and trying to claim that it was the contents of this week's issue of Famitsu.

In the meantime, one of NeoGAF's forum users has posted a separate thread with the actual contents of this week's Famitsu.
